Я получаю повторяющиеся изменения слияния на соединении с черепахой svn.То, на что я надеялся, было то, что, как только я сделаю слияние, это не должно произойти.Вот шаги, которые я считаю, я делаю.Нужна помощь, если я что-то делаю не так.
- Я нахожусь в корне папки моей ветки.Я не использую
svn switch
или что-то еще, но определенно я в корне папки моей ветки.И изменения по коммиту идут только в ветку.Надеюсь, это не имеет никакого значения. - Я делаю щелчок правой кнопкой мыши.Перейдите в раздел «Черепаха SVN» -> «Объединить» -> «Объединить диапазон ревизий» -> в раскрывающемся списке «Слить мой URL-адрес магистрали» -> оставить диапазон ревизий пустым.-> Выполнить слияние (пробовал слияние тестов и запись слияния всевозможных опций, но я считаю, что нажатие кнопки «Слияние» - правильный подход, верно?)
- Тогда я получаю изменения.Здесь, после некоторого прочтения вопросов stackoverflow, я попробовал SVN commit и даже делал
svn update
до svn commit
.Изменение вступает в силу с увеличенной ревизией. - Я также проверяю свойства svnmerge.Он правильно показывает правильную ревизию ИЛИ на одну ревизию меньше непосредственно перед фиксацией.
- ПРОБЛЕМА заключается в том, что при повторном слиянии я получаю тот же набор изменений.Разве тот же набор изменений не должен повториться?Я ожидаю, что он не появится снова, если я повторю шаг 2. Пожалуйста, помогите мне с правильным подходом.